Training with purpose  |
|
I used to train my putting like many other amateurs - just getting on the putting field, trying to hole the ball in the next free hole. Now I train with a purpose every time I take my putter. Pelz scientific approach not only helps with setting up a training regime for using your training time effecient but also expands your knowledge about green reading, speed, clubs, strokes, training aids...... and everything else you ever wanted to know about putting. This book is a "must-have"

Eliminates the mysteries of putting  |
|
Untill I read this book I hated putting, especially those long ones from the edge of the green. Pelz really covers all aspects, from stroke mechanics to the roll on the greens. After reading this I have seen a lot more putts drop and my confidence soar. The only reason why I didnt give this one top marks is due to the laborious read; although definately worth purchasing if you are keen to overcome those putting nightmares, it felt a bit like one of my old uni text books.

All you ever wanted to know about putting....and more.  |
|
I highly recommend this book, just have patience. It is heavy stuff! Dont buy this if you have a short attention span. The man loves the look of his own words in print, and boy are there a lot of his words. At times the level of detail is boring, like the effect of hitting the dimples, BUT if you want to improve your putting, this IS the book for you. In three months I have reduced my admittedly miserable average by 4.61 putts per round in the first 6 medal rounds of this year. The instructional part is very clear and easy to understand, and it has certainly worked for me. There is a supporting video available and it is good, but I highly recommend the book if you are seriously keen to improve your putting.
